psql: 致命错误: 对用户"user1"的对等认证失败
2016-10-14 19:01
513 查看
操作系统:Debian8
登录pg时可能会有提示错误:
打开以下文件,
将 peer 改为md5:
然后重启服务:
再登录即可:
-- End --
登录pg时可能会有提示错误:
$ psql -U user1 -d exampledb psql: 致命错误: 对用户"user1"的对等认证失败
打开以下文件,
$ sudo vi /etc/postgresql/9.4/main/pg_hba.conf
# TYPE DATABASE USER ADDRESS METHOD # "local" is for Unix domain socket connections only local all all peer # IPv4 local connections: host all all 127.0.0.1/32 md5 # IPv6 local connections: host all all ::1/128 md5
将 peer 改为md5:
# TYPE DATABASE USER ADDRESS METHOD # "local" is for Unix domain socket connections only local all all md5 # IPv4 local connections: host all all 127.0.0.1/32 md5 # IPv6 local connections: host all all ::1/128 md5
然后重启服务:
$ sudo service postgresql restart
再登录即可:
$ psql -U user1 -d exampledb
-- End --
相关文章推荐
- psql: 致命错误: 用户 "postgres" Ident 认证失败
- psql: 致命错误: 用户 "libreplan" Ident 认证失败
- centos7.2 postgresql 9.2 用户名登录 ‘psql: 致命错误: 用户 "postgres" Ident 认证失败’
- rails连接postgresql错误:psql: 致命错误: 用户 "postgres" Ident 认证失败
- 从 "org.apache.hadoop.security.AccessControlException:Permission denied: user=..." 看Hadoop 的用户登陆认证
- 解决 {"ret":100030,"msg":"this api without user authorization"} android QQ第三发登录成功后获取用户信息失败的问题
- 开机登录失败 提示"user profile service服务未能登录,无法加载用户配置文件" 问题解决办法
- 从 "org.apache.hadoop.security.AccessControlException:Permission denied: user=..." 看Hadoop 的用户登陆认证
- 用户"sa "登陆失败 SQLServer 错误18456 图解
- 用户"sa "登陆失败 SQLServer 错误18456----解决方法(转)
- 用户"sa"登陆失败,SQL Server错误:18452/18456
- "用户 'sa' 登录失败。原因: 该帐户被禁用。"的解决方案
- ubuntu切换用户root时认证失败
- [SQL Server] 如何查询windows认证的用户连接数据库时的"权限/对应的登陆账号"(该账号是一个windows组)
- hadoop "File /user/<user>/input/conf/slaves could only be replicated to 0 nodes, instead of 1"问题及解决办
- hadoop "File /user/<user>/input/conf/slaves could only be replicated to 0 nodes, instead of 1"问题及解决办
- 无法打开登录所请求的数据库 ""。登录失败。用户*登录失败。解决办法
- 无法打开登录所请求的数据库 "ASPState"。登录失败。 用户 'NT AUTHORITY/SYSTEM' 登录失败。
- 用户"sa"登陆失败 SQLServer 错误18456的解决方法
- JS在用户输入的时候格式化数字为财务数字,如"123,123,1.123,1"